Background
The shuttle-woven-like warp knitted fabric is a warp knitted fabric which is relatively concerned by the sports wear market recently, the existing warp knitted fabric in the market is an elastic fabric formed by chemical fibers and elastic spandex, the yarn hooking performance of the fabric is poor, in addition, the physical property of the elastic spandex is limited, the risk of breakage is caused after the fabric is placed for a long time, the wearing performance of the fabric is weakened, and the clothes resistance and the stiff feeling similar to those of shuttle (woven) fabrics are difficult to achieve.
Patent CN202766761U discloses a prevent colluding warp knitting silk face of silk and draw a frame surface fabric, by the scarce pad tissue that GB1, GB2, GB3, GB4 four sley bars were woven, and GB1, GB2, GB3, GB4 are full-length, and GB4 covers partial GB1 extension line. The GB1 extension line is bound by adjusting the fabric structure, so that the problem of hooking of long extension lines due to lack of a pad structure is effectively solved, and the comfort of the fabric in the aspect of skin attachment is enhanced. However, the elastic spandex used as the raw material in the technology is difficult to achieve the stiff and firm clothing resistance similar to woven fabrics, and the wearability of the fabric is difficult to improve.

Detailed Description
For further understanding of the features and technical means of the present invention, as well as the specific objects and functions attained by the present invention, the present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ings and detailed description.
As shown in the attached drawings 1 and 6, the elastic imitated tatting warp knitting fabric with the snagging prevention function and the spandex-free function comprises a fabric body which is formed by weaving at least two guide bars on a single needle bed warp knitting machine, wherein the fabric body comprises a compact surface layer 1 and an elastic layer 2, the elastic layer and the compact surface layer are integrally woven, and the elastic layer has a dragging function on the compact surface layer. The compact surface layer is formed by weaving at least one guide bar with fiber yarns by adopting a chain, warp flat or warp satin weave; the elastic layer is formed by weaving at least one guide bar by warp velvet or warp diagonal texture with non-spandex elastic yarns; the tight surface layer and the elastic layer are integrally woven, the elastic layer keeps retracting to pull the tight surface layer, namely, yarns forming the tight surface layer are tensioned, so that the cloth surface of the tight surface layer is tighter and smoother, the hand feeling is stiff, and the yarn hooking is not easy.
The fiber yarn is composed of a plurality of same fibers or a plurality of different fibers, and comprises terylene, nylon and cotton. The fiber yarn is chemical fiber filament or staple fiber, or the combination of chemical fiber filament and staple fiber.
The linear density of the fiber yarn is between 5 and 150 deniers, and the linear density of the non-spandex elastic yarn is between 5 and 150 deniers. The non-spandex yarn is nylon, terylene high-elasticity yarn or low-elasticity yarn, high-shrinkage yarn, T400 yarn, H300 yarn or H400 yarn. The density of knitting needles of the single needle bar warp knitting machine is between 28 and 40 needles per inch.
The density of the fabric body is that WPC is more than or equal to 15, CPC is more than or equal to 18, WPI is more than or equal to 38, CPI is more than or equal to 45, preferably, WPC is more than or equal to 18, CPC is more than or equal to 21, WPI is more than or equal to 45, CPI is more than or equal to 53. The fabric body has a warp and weft opening of 20-100%, preferably 30-70%.
The following is a description of specific examples.
First embodiment, as shown in fig. 2 and 3, a fabric body is formed by knitting with two guide bars, a guide bar GB1 and a guide bar GB2, on a single needle bed warp knitting machine. GB1 adopts chemical fiber filament, 2 closed needles are knitted into a tight surface layer by a flat structure; GB2 adopts non-spandex elastic chemical fiber filament, and the elastic layer is formed by knitting a reverse closed 3-needle warp knitting structure, so that the elastic layer without spandex is obtained. And then the elastic layer is subjected to post-treatment, such as evaporation or other forms of contraction treatment, so that the elastic layer has a certain retraction effect, the cloth surface of the compact surface layer can be better and compact after full retraction, the GB1 chemical fiber filament is tensioned by the elastic layer, a good effect of preventing snagging is achieved, the fabric is woven by adopting yarns and non-spandex elastic yarn raw materials (at least one non-spandex elastic yarn is used for weaving), and the fabric has the advantages of preventing snagging, not containing spandex and being elastic in tatting-like weaving.
Second embodiment, as shown in fig. 4 and 5, a single needle bed warp knitting machine uses two guide bars GB1 and GB2 to form a fabric body. GB1 adopts chemical fiber filament, open-end chain knitting organization structure, and forms a compact surface layer by knitting; GB2 adopts non-spandex elastic chemical fiber filament to form an elastic layer by weaving through an oblique structure, thereby obtaining the elastic layer without spandex. And then the elastic layer is subjected to post-treatment, such as evaporation or other forms of contraction treatment, so that the elastic layer has a certain retraction effect, the cloth surface of the compact surface layer can be better and compact after full retraction, the GB1 chemical fiber filament is tensioned by the elastic layer, a good effect of preventing snagging is achieved, the fabric is woven by adopting yarns and non-spandex elastic yarn raw materials (at least one non-spandex elastic yarn is used for weaving), and the fabric has the advantages of preventing snagging, not containing spandex and being elastic in tatting-like weaving.
When specifically weaving, the following method is adopted:
1. warping yarns used in warp knitting:
1) warping of chemical fiber filaments:
the warping machine type: karl Mayer DS 21/30 NC-2, negative feed.
Warping temperature: warping humidity at 25 ℃: 65 percent of
And setting process parameters in the workshop under the conditions of the temperature and the humidity.
2) Warping of non-spandex elastic chemical fiber filaments:
the warping machine type: karl Mayer DS 21/30 NC-2, negative feed.
Warping temperature: warping humidity at 25 ℃: 65 percent of
And setting process parameters in the workshop under the conditions of the temperature and the humidity.
2. Weaving
Weaving machine model: karl Mayer HKS2-3E, HKS2-3, HKS2-S, HKS4-1, RSE4-1, HKS4-1EL or other single bar warp knitting machines (which may be tricot or Raschel).
The machine number range is as follows: E28-E40
The threading mode is full threading
The yarns used in the fabric were: chemical fiber filament and non-spandex elastic chemical fiber filament.
For example, fig. 2 and 3 show the structural schematic diagram of the fabric, GB1 uses chemical fiber filament, and the closed 2-needle warp flat structure, GB2 uses non-spandex elastic chemical fiber filament, and the reverse closed 3-needle warp pile structure.
For example, fig. 4 and 5 show the structural schematic diagram of the fabric, GB1 uses chemical fiber filament and a chain stitch structure, and GB2 uses non-spandex elastic chemical fiber filament and a warp bias structure.
3, dyeing and finishing
Dry cleaning (or water washing) → reservation → rolling → overflow dyeing → dewatering → finishing

Example 1:
the goods number is: t229396
Color: black color
The use model is as follows: HKS4-1,32GG,130 inches
Yarn laying number: GB 1: 1-0/1-2//; GB 2: 2-3/1-0//
The raw materials are used: GB 1: PET 75/72 SD DTY polyester; GB 2: Elastell-PET 50/36 SD FDY (T400)
Breadth: 180CM
Gram weight: 240GSM
Physical testing parameters (method-hook wire-ASTM D3939-Snag-600 turns)
Length Rating :4.5
Width Rating :4.5
Physical testing parameters (method-hook wire-BS 8479-Snag-standard template-2000 turn)
Length Rating :4.5
Width Rating :4.5
Physical testing parameters (method-opening-LTD 03-Effective Load-7.5 lbf)
Length(hem%):30%
Width(middle%):50%
Example 2:
the goods number is: t2201363
Color: black color
The use model is as follows: HKS4-1,32GG,130 inches
Yarn laying number: GB 1: 1-0/0-1//; GB 2: 1-0/3-4//
The raw materials are used: GB 1: PET 75/72 SD DTY polyester; GB 2: Elastell-PET 50/36 SD FDY (T400)
Breadth: 170CM
Gram weight: 230GSM
Physical testing parameters (method-hook wire-ASTM D3939-Snag-600 turns)
Length Rating :4.5
Width Rating :4.5
Physical testing parameters (method-hook wire-BS 8479-Snag-standard template-2000 turn)
Length Rating :4.5
Width Rating :4.5
Physical testing parameters (method-opening-LTD 03-Effective Load-7.5 lbf)
Length(hem%):30%
Width(middle%):55%。
